Finance Review Summary — Pellgrave Licensing Dispute

Quick rundown for department heads: the disagreement with Northam Creative over the Pellgrave toolkit licence is still rumbling on. They claim our usage exceeded the seat cap; our logs say otherwise, but the contract wording is, frankly, a bit woolly. We've booked a modest provision this quarter just in case, and legal costs are running about as expected. Cash impact so far is minor, and mediation is pencilled in for early next quarter. Context on where this fits strategically is below.

management briefing: Silethax Systems plans to raise the Holix list price by 50.2 percent in December. The steering committee signed off on a budget of $329.9 million for Project Holok. The renewal with Juldorax Foods closes at $278.2 million a year, 54.3 percent above the last contract. Project Briir slips by one quarter because of the supplier delay.

Autocomplete on the Pellick search bar was slow because the prefix index rebuilt on every keystroke past three chars. This PR debounces rebuilds, caps candidate fanout, and shards the trie by first character. Benchmarks in the Orvane test rig show p95 down from 420ms to 60ms. Tuning knobs are centralized here rather than scattered. Current values follow.

tuning constants:
BUDGETS = {
    "druath": 240,
    "lamwyn": 180,
    "silael": 275,
}

## Changelog — FareLab v2.8

For the dynamic ticket-pricing experiment, the variable previously called `FL_EXP_KEY` is now `FL_PRICING_SECRET`. This clarifies that it gates write access to experiment assignments, not read access. The legacy name is removed entirely; both names set at once will abort startup. New team members updating an environment should add this line:

env line for fafof-fahag: LEDGER_TOKEN5=f8790